From 1157c9c0eca6484e197aaeb941ac7ce572a5cc03 Mon Sep 17 00:00:00 2001
From: liurunyu <lry9898@163.com>
Date: 星期三, 05 二月 2025 11:25:51 +0800
Subject: [PATCH] 取水口综合信息:监控数据信息,统计数据信息
---
pipIrr-platform/pipIrr-global/src/main/java/com/dy/pipIrrGlobal/daoBa/BaBlockMapper.java | 95 +++++++++++++++++++++++++++++++++--------------
1 files changed, 66 insertions(+), 29 deletions(-)
diff --git a/pipIrr-platform/pipIrr-global/src/main/java/com/dy/pipIrrGlobal/daoBa/BaBlockMapper.java b/pipIrr-platform/pipIrr-global/src/main/java/com/dy/pipIrrGlobal/daoBa/BaBlockMapper.java
index 2105c40..b7a48f5 100644
--- a/pipIrr-platform/pipIrr-global/src/main/java/com/dy/pipIrrGlobal/daoBa/BaBlockMapper.java
+++ b/pipIrr-platform/pipIrr-global/src/main/java/com/dy/pipIrrGlobal/daoBa/BaBlockMapper.java
@@ -2,41 +2,16 @@
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
import com.dy.pipIrrGlobal.pojoBa.BaBlock;
-import com.dy.pipIrrGlobal.pojoBa.BaPrivilege;
+import com.dy.pipIrrGlobal.voBa.VoBlock;
+import com.dy.pipIrrGlobal.voBa.VoMapCoordinates;
+import com.dy.pipIrrGlobal.voBa.VoMapGraph;
import org.apache.ibatis.annotations.Mapper;
import java.util.List;
import java.util.Map;
@Mapper
-public interface BaBlockMapper extends BaseMapper<BaPrivilege> {
- /**
- * delete by primary key
- * @param id primaryKey
- * @return deleteCount
- */
- int deleteByPrimaryKey(Long id);
-
- /**
- * 閫昏緫鍒犻櫎
- * @param id primaryKey
- * @return update count
- */
- int deleteLogicById(Long id);
-
- /**
- * insert record to table
- * @param record the record
- * @return insert count
- */
- int insert(BaBlock record);
-
- /**
- * insert record to table selective
- * @param record the record
- * @return insert count
- */
- int insertSelective(BaBlock record);
+public interface BaBlockMapper extends BaseMapper<BaBlock> {
/**
* select by primary key
@@ -44,6 +19,13 @@
* @return object by primary key
*/
BaBlock selectByPrimaryKey(Long id);
+
+
+ /**
+ * 寰楀埌鍏ㄩ儴瀹炰綋
+ * @return 鍏ㄩ儴瀹炰綋
+ */
+ List<BaBlock> selectAll() ;
/**
@@ -61,6 +43,48 @@
List<BaBlock> selectSome(Map<?, ?> params) ;
/**
+ * 鏍规嵁鎸囧畾鏉′欢鑾峰彇鐗囧尯璁板綍鏁伴噺
+ * @param params
+ * @return
+ */
+ Long getBlocksCount(Map<?, ?> params) ;
+
+ /**
+ * 鏍规嵁鎸囧畾鏉′欢鑾峰彇鐗囧尯
+ * @param params
+ * @return
+ */
+ List<VoBlock> getBlocks(Map<?, ?> params) ;
+
+ /**
+ * 鏍规嵁鐗囧尯ID鑾峰彇鍦板浘鍥惧舰鍒楄〃
+ * @param blockId
+ * @return
+ */
+ List<VoMapGraph> gertMapGraphsByBlockId(Long blockId);
+
+ /**
+ * 鏍规嵁鍦板浘鍥惧舰ID鑾峰彇鍦板浘鍥惧舰鍧愭爣鍒楄〃
+ * @param graphId
+ * @return
+ */
+ List<VoMapCoordinates> getCoordinatesByGraphId(Long graphId);
+
+ /**
+ * insert record to table
+ * @param record the record
+ * @return insert count
+ */
+ int putin(BaBlock record);
+
+ /**
+ * insert record to table selective
+ * @param record the record
+ * @return insert count
+ */
+ int insertSelective(BaBlock record);
+
+ /**
* update record selective
* @param record the updated record
* @return update count
@@ -73,4 +97,17 @@
* @return update count
*/
int updateByPrimaryKey(BaBlock record);
+ /**
+ * 瀹為檯鍒犻櫎
+ * @param id primaryKey
+ * @return deleteCount
+ */
+ int deleteByPrimaryKey(Long id);
+
+ /**
+ * 閫昏緫鍒犻櫎
+ * @param id primaryKey
+ * @return update count
+ */
+ int deleteLogicById(Long id);
}
\ No newline at end of file
--
Gitblit v1.8.0